我希望在查询MongoDB时根据列的不同值创建不同的数据帧。
例如 - 现在写我正在过滤整个集合并为一个广告系列创建一个数据框。
query = mongo.bson.buffer.create()
mongo.bson.buffer.append(query,"campaign", "Belt Buckles")
query<-mongo.bson.from.buffer(query)
cursor = mongo.find(mongo, ns=DBNS, query= query)
但是我有七个不同的广告系列,查询应该能够自己识别不同的广告系列,并从MongoDB创建不同的数据框
应该如何表达&#34; distinct&#34;在我的查询中?
示例数据 -
以下是样本数据
IS LISR LISB campaign
90 5 5 Belts
95 2.5 2.5 Books
80 10 10 Books
70 15 15 Bags
75 12 13 Bags
65 15 20 Belts
我希望皮带,书籍,包装成不同的数据框